What is UNECE Regulation No. 118 (R118) Fire Safety Testing?

UNECE Regulation No. 118 (R118), issued by the United Nations Economic Commission for Europe (UNECE), sets mandatory fire safety standards for automotive interior materials.

The regulation addresses fire risks on two levels: vehicle type approval, which ensures all the interior material used in the vehicle comply with safety requirements, and component or material approval, which tests individual interior elements such as seat fabrics, curtains, insulation, and electrical cables.

R118 applies primarily to M3 category vehicles, especially Class II and Class III buses, coaches and certain commercial vehicles. It aims to reduce fire risks by regulating flammability, melting behaviour, and cable burning properties etc.

What are the key tests?

To comply with R118, vehicle interior components, including seats, panels, insulation, floor coverings, and cables, must pass specific tests under various annexes, such as:

  • Annex 6 – Horizontal burning rate for interior materials – Materials used inside passenger compartments must burn at a rate of ≤ 100 mm/min.
  • Annex 7 – Melting behaviour – Materials should not produce flaming droplets that could spread fire.
  • Annex 8 – Vertical burning test – Materials must self-extinguish quickly after being exposed to a flame.
  • Annex 9 – Smoke density and toxicity – Limits the opacity of smoke from insulation materials in the engine compartment to maintain visibility for safe evacuation. Restricts the emission of toxic gases from burning materials used in the engine compartment.
  • Annex 10 – Burning behaviour of electrical cables – Cables longer than 100 mm must pass flame resistance and spread tests to prevent fire propagation.

Sample preparation services

We handle preparation of samples to meet UNECE R118 requirements, including conditioning, cutting, labelling, and documentation. Samples are mounted in the same orientation (horizontal or vertical) as installed in the vehicle to ensure realistic test results.

Typical dimensions for R118 tests include:

  • Annex 6 – 356 × 100 × 13 mm (Length × Width × Thickness)
  • Annex 7 – 70 × 70 × 13 mm
  • Annex 8 – 560 × 170 × 13 mm
  • Annex 9 – 140 × 140 × 5 mm
  • Annex 10 – minimum 600 mm length (for cables)
